手机游戏软件是一种为手机用户提供娱乐与休闲的应用程序。究竟该如何制作手机游戏软件呢?
制作手机游戏软件需要以下步骤:
1.确定游戏类型和目标受众:选择适合的游戏类型,根据目标受众的喜好和需求确定游戏的主题和特性。
2.设计游戏规则和流程:制定游戏规则,设计游戏关卡和流程,并确保游戏的难度和平衡性,以保持用户的兴趣。
3.开发游戏场景和角色:创建游戏场景和角色的图像和动画,确保界面美观,与游戏主题相符。
4.编写游戏代码和逻辑:使用合适的编程语言和开发工具,编写游戏的功能代码,包括用户交互、游戏机制和音效等。
5.测试和优化:在游戏开发过程中进行测试,找出并修复游戏中的漏洞和错误,优化游戏性能和用户体验。
6.发布和推广:将游戏发布到应用商店或游戏平台,并进行推广活动,吸引用户下载和体验游戏。
为提高游戏用户体验,可以采取以下措施:
1.确保游戏的操作简单易懂,界面清晰明了,避免复杂的操作和混乱的界面设计。
2.增加游戏的趣味性和挑战性,使玩家能够享受游戏的刺激和快乐。
3.优化游戏的加载速度和运行效率,减少卡顿和延迟现象,提升用户的流畅度。
4.提供良好的音效和音乐,使用户在游戏中能够享受到沉浸式的体验。
5.通过用户反馈和数据分析,不断改进和更新游戏,满足用户的需求和期待。
要增加游戏的可玩性,可以考虑以下方法:
1.设计多样化的关卡和任务,使玩家能够有不同的挑战和目标。
2.引入社交功能,如多人对战、好友互动等,增加玩家之间的互动性。
3.提供奖励和成就系统,激励玩家不断进步和探索游戏的更多内容。
4.定期更新和扩展游戏内容,增加新的角色、道具和游戏模式,保持游戏的新鲜感。
5.与其他游戏或应用进行合作,推出跨界联动活动,吸引更多玩家参与游戏。
手机游戏软件开发需要掌握以下技术和工具:
1.编程语言:如Java、C#、C++等,用于开发游戏逻辑和功能。
2.开发工具:如Unity、Cocos2d-x等,提供游戏开发的环境和工具。
3.图像处理:如Photoshop、Illustrator等,用于设计和处理游戏中的图像和动画。
4.音频处理:如Audacity、FMOD等,用于制作和编辑游戏中的音效和音乐。
5.版本控制系统:如Git、SVN等,用于管理和协作开发过程中的代码版本。
6.数据分析工具:如Google Analytics、Mixpanel等,用于分析和评估游戏的数据和用户行为。
为确保游戏的安全性和稳定性,可以采取以下措施:
1.加密和防作弊:采用加密技术,保护游戏的数据和用户信息,防止作弊行为的发生。
2.错误监控和修复:在游戏发布后,及时监控游戏中出现的错误和漏洞,并进行修复和更新。
3.服务器管理和优化:对游戏的服务器进行管理和优化,提高游戏的稳定性和响应速度。
4.用户支持和反馈:为用户提供及时的技术支持,并接受用户的意见和建议,不断改善游戏质量。
以上是关于手机游戏软件如何制作的一些问题和回答,希望对您有所帮助。制作手机游戏软件需要技术和创意的结合,同时要关注用户体验和市场需求,才能开发出受欢迎的游戏产品。